Transaction 918a323f5e1db774e0304a332db889692484c5a6c29ea698e02be496d7f039af
1 Input
1 Output
-
918a323f5e1db774e0304a332db889692484c5a6c29ea698e02be496d7f039af:0
- value
- 2031635
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c6f66f04216d1583189ca73a82f608496e277ee5 OP_EQUAL
- address
- 3Kq2w369AC34KT1aE3uZXfXTbg999ACDqv